Other Notes: Sushi, in Afghanistan? I know, I was skeptical at first as well. Note I’m a Sushi hound! I could eat it three meals a day. I can out eat anyone in sushi. That is just some background for you.

Now, The Bentoya Restaurant isn’t easy to find. It’s in the Galleria, near the Dutch Embassy. If you get that close, call for directions. Its one turn, then a little set of orange gates separates you from this neat little find in Kabul. Security is only moderately good. They need to add a sally port and full time guard and they can be put on most security firm’s “approved” list.

Before you get to the restaurant, which is a tiny little place, you will pass through some really neat bric-a-brac stores. The entire place is one neat cubby hole after another. Once you find the Bentoya Restaurant, you’ll see it’s an open window for the take out crowd. But, if you time it right and/or call ahead, you can get one of these great tables set in a very quiet room to enjoy the food.

As for the food, it was yummy. The meal I ordered had the Maki sushi, which, while a good roll, and it was prepared excellently, does not contain any fish. In fact, none of their sushi contains fish. It’s impossible to get fresh fish of that caliber here in country. But the plate did come with chopsticks. I wasn’t expecting that.

The owner is a great, delightful lady. Very friendly, and helpful (as I can attest to after my multiple phone calls for directions.) One thing that is lacking, but totally understandable, Sake. It’s a shame because it would have rounded the meal perfectly!
